You can use the properties of logarithm to get to the solution.

The approximate value for given term is given by

log_3(14) \approx 2.402

<h3>What is logarithm and some of its useful properties?</h3>

When you raise a number with an exponent, there comes a result.

Lets say you get

a^b = c

Then, you can write 'b' in terms of 'a' and 'c' using logarithm as follows

b = log_a(c)

Some properties of logarithm are:

log_a(b) = log_a(c) \implies b = c\\\\\log_a(b) + log_a(c) = log_a(b \times c)\\\\log_a(b) - log_a(c) = log_a(\frac{b}{c})

<h3>Using the above properties</h3>

log_3(2) + log_3(7) = log_3(2 \times 7) = log_3(14)\\\\0.631 + 1.771  = log_3(14)\\\\log_3(14) = 2.402

Thus,

The approximate value for given term is given by

log_3(14) \approx 2.402
